K130517 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the EZ TRANSPORT CHAIR. Classified as Wheelchair, Mechanical (product code IOR), Class I - General Controls.

Submitted by Harris Medical, LLC (Amherst,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on February 25, 2014 after a review of 363 days - an unusually long review period, suggesting complex equivalence evaluation.

This device falls under the Physical Medicine F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 890.3850 - the FDA physical medicine device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

IOR Device Classification - Class 1, General Controls

Product Code IOR Wheelchair, Mechanical
Device Class Class 1 - General Controls
CFR Regulation 21 CFR 890.3850
Definition A Mechanical Wheelchair Is A Manually Operated Device With Wheels That Is Intended For Medical Purposes To Provide Mobility To Persons Restricted To A Sitting Position. Fda Interprets “mobility To Persons Restricted To A Sitting Position” To Mean The Device Type Is Intended To Provide Mobility To Individuals Who Have Mobility Impairments And/or Require An Assistive Device For Mobility.
What this classification means

Class I devices are subject to general controls only and most are exempt from 510(k) premarket notification. They represent the lowest regulatory burden in the FDA device framework.
